| Venue | County Ground, Northampton on 23rd, 24th, 25th May 1987 (3-day match) |
| Balls per over | 6 |
| Toss | Northamptonshire won the toss and decided to bat |
| Result | Match drawn |
| Points | Northamptonshire 6 (Batting 2, Bowling 4); Leicestershire 5 (Batting 1, Bowling 4) |
| Umpires | DO Oslear, NT Plews |
| Close of play day 1 | No play |
| Close of play day 2 | Leicestershire (1) 29/0 (Potter 7*, Cobb 15*) |
